In the world of engineering and construction, connections between different components are crucial for ensuring stability and functionality. One such type of connection that is widely used is the screwed connection. A screwed connection refers to a method of fastening two or more parts together using screws. This technique is not only efficient but also provides a strong bond that can withstand various forces acting upon it.When we think about the importance of a screwed connection, we must consider its applications in everyday life. For instance, furniture assembly often relies on this type of connection. Many flat-pack furniture items come with screws and pre-drilled holes, allowing consumers to easily assemble their items at home. The effectiveness of these screwed connections ensures that the furniture is stable and safe to use, preventing accidents that might occur due to weak joints.Moreover, in the field of construction, screwed connections play a vital role in building structures. Whether it is connecting beams in a house or securing panels in a commercial building, the strength provided by screws is indispensable. Engineers and architects often choose screwed connections because they can be easily adjusted or removed if needed, allowing for flexibility in design and construction.Another significant advantage of screwed connections is their versatility. They can be used with a variety of materials, including wood, metal, and plastic. This adaptability makes them a preferred choice in many industries, from automotive to aerospace. In these fields, the reliability of a screwed connection is paramount, as even the smallest failure could lead to catastrophic results.However, it is essential to recognize that screwed connections also have their limitations. Over time, screws can become loose due to vibrations or thermal expansion, which may compromise the integrity of the connection. To mitigate this issue, engineers often incorporate additional methods, such as using lock washers or adhesives, to enhance the reliability of the screwed connection.In conclusion, the role of screwed connections in various applications cannot be overstated. They provide strength, versatility, and ease of use, making them an essential element in both everyday items and complex structures. As technology advances, the methods and materials used for screwed connections will continue to evolve, but their fundamental importance in engineering and construction will remain unchanged. Understanding and mastering the concept of screwed connections is crucial for anyone involved in these fields, as it lays the groundwork for creating safe and reliable products and structures.
